  2. I have good news: I heard back from someone at our district office. We had talked about this before and she had previously said that they were discussing the situation--that was in mid-May. What she told me was that they were not going to ban caches in the Jefferson National Forest area or require a $59 permit per cache for any hides within the Forest area. They didn't encourage caching in the JNF, but they weren't going to go hunt them down, either. I did advise her that my geocaches were not placed in any environmentally sensitive areas, and she was very polite and said she appreciated me asking them about this.
